What Are the Abuse Allegations at This Michigan Facility?

More than 50 women have come forward, saying they were abused at Vista Maria, a residential facility for girls in Dearborn Heights…a place that was supposed to protect them. According to MLive, the allegations span decades. Absolutely disgusting.

The lawsuit names six women, but it also includes claims from dozens of others…with allegations going all the way back to 2000 and continuing into recent years…
